Transaction 2bf80dcd5867fec1f993004ac3d9608bd142d3191f2e6ad6c71f3601092f75aa

86 Input
1 Outputs
  • 2bf80dcd5867fec1f993004ac3d9608bd142d3191f2e6ad6c71f3601092f75aa:0
  • value  71147006
    address  32kbnYJ6YVWc6sBt4pj4yuFJfDNDnRs72L